There is NO relation between new versions of Array.au3 and SciTE (SciTE4AutoIt3 installer).

SciTE is the editor I support and only a Lite version is added to the AutoIt3 Installer.

The AutoIt installer contains all UDF files, so you need to look for either the latest Production or BEta version of AutoIt3 when looking for latest UDF updates.
